PM Tarique Rahman to launch Family Card distribution on March 10
Prime Minister Tarique Rahman will inaugurate the Family Card distribution programme on March 10, Women and Children Affairs and Social Welfare Minister Professor Dr Abu Jafar Md Zahid Hossain announced on Tuesday afternoon.
Family card holders will receive Tk 2,500 per month, the Social Welfare Minister said.
He stated that beneficiaries will be selected completely impartially, without any political considerations. The programme will begin as a pilot project in 13 upazilas. After four months, three categories of ultra-poor individuals across the country will receive Family Cards in phases.
"On March 10, the Prime Minister will inaugurate the piloting of the Family Card distribution project. We have currently designated 14 upazilas across various divisions of Bangladesh for this programme. Family Cards will be distributed universally in one ward of one union from each of these 14 upazilas. Inshallah, the programme will begin simultaneously in these 14 upazilas on March 10. This is an ongoing process and will be expanded across Bangladesh in phases," the minister said.
Through the Family Card, beneficiaries from three categories—ultra-poor, poor and lower-income group—particularly mothers, will receive this benefit, he added.
"Our goal is women's empowerment and making them economically self-reliant. We believe that when a woman becomes self-reliant, a family becomes self-reliant, and through this, the next generation will also become self-reliant," the minister said.
He further informed that Prime Minister Tarique Rahman has been working on this project for a long time. The project was approved today at a meeting chaired by him, attended by relevant ministers, advisers and senior officials. Beneficiaries will receive Tk 2,500 per month through this Family Card.
